10 Pick Your Own Farms Near Isle of Palms SC

Boone Hall Farms

This Mt. Pleasant farm is the closest pick-your-own to Isle of Palms and features a rotating selection of fruits available for picking. Make sure to bring your own bag or you will have to buy one of their own bags for $2.

Blue Pearl Farms

This McClellanville farm plays host to thousands of blueberry bushes, bee colonies, and vegetable gardens. This family-friendly farm is best visited during the summer season for its big blueberries and grapes.

Patriots Farm

The “strawberry farm,” Patriots Farm is a well-known strawberry u-pick farm where you can pick a bucket of strawberries for $7.50 or pre-picked for $10.

Champney’s Blueberry Farm

An SC-certified family-owned and operated blueberry farm, Champney’s Blueberry Farm is a masterclass to visit each and every blueberry season. Make sure to check their Facebook page to see if they are open as the blueberry season is very much first come first serve.

Bugby Plantation U-Pick

Open rain or shine, Bugby Plantation U-Pick is a seasonal farm found on Wadmalaw Island. Known for their tomatoes and strawberries, they also have other southern favorites such as corn and watermelon.

Freeman Produce Stand

Freeman Produce Stand is located on Johns Island and has a wide variety of fruits/vegetables that includes: tomatoes, peas, squash, strawberries, greens, cucumbers, blueberries, cabbage, watermelon, and more!

Flowers at Rosebank Farms

You can pick more than just flowers at Rosebank Farms on Johns Island. Whether you are in the market for local honey, baked good from a local bakery, or fresh produce they have it all!

King’s Market

At King’s Market, you can expect to pick beans, cucumbers, peaches, peppers, tomatoes, corns, flowers, squash, and more! This family-owned farm market is an Edisto Island institution and makes for a great day trip.

Charpia Farms

A family-owned and operated farm in Summerville, SC, Charpia Farms is known for its corn, collard/mustard greens, turnips, and rutabagas.

Hickory Bluff Nursery and Berry Farm

Opened seasonally from April-July you can pick strawberries, blueberries, blackberries, and farm-fresh vegetables/local honey already picked/bottled respectively at Hickory Bluff Nursery and Berry Farm.
